About Funds & Asset Management Law in Larissa, Greece

Funds and asset management law in Larissa, Greece is an important area that governs how investment funds are established, managed, and regulated, as well as how assets are managed on behalf of investors. Larissa, being one of the largest cities in Greece and a regional financial hub, has seen a steady increase in demand for professional asset management services, both for individual and institutional investors. The legal framework is primarily shaped by national laws that align with European Union directives. These laws focus on regulation of investment vehicles, safeguarding investors, ensuring transparency, and maintaining financial stability.

Local Laws Overview

Funds and asset management in Larissa follow Greece’s institutional and regulatory legal framework, which is consistent with EU directives such as UCITS (Undertakings for Collective Investment in Transferable Securities) and AIFMD (Alternative Investment Fund Managers Directive). Key aspects include:

  • Licensing regimes for asset managers and fund administrators by the Hellenic Capital Market Commission (HCMC)
  • Mandatory registration and reporting for investment funds
  • Requirements for fund documentation, offering prospectuses, and investor disclosures
  • Anti-money laundering and anti-terrorist financing compliance obligations
  • Strict segregation of client assets from fund manager assets
  • Periodic audits and financial reporting requirements
  • Rules governing taxation of funds, investors, and manager fees
  • Provisions for investor protection and recourse mechanisms in case of disputes or mismanagement

Anyone involved in setting up or managing funds in Larissa must ensure ongoing compliance with these evolving laws and consult with local legal professionals for tailored guidance.

Frequently Asked Questions

What types of investment funds can be established in Larissa, Greece?

The main types include mutual funds, closed-ended funds, alternative investment funds, and specialized UCITS funds. Each has different regulatory requirements and tax obligations.

Who regulates funds and asset managers in Larissa?

The Hellenic Capital Market Commission (HCMC) is the primary regulator for funds and asset managers throughout Greece, including Larissa.

Do I need a local advisor to manage assets in Larissa?

While it is not always mandatory, having a local advisor helps ensure compliance with Greek laws, especially regarding fund licensing, reporting, and tax matters.

What legal structures are available for asset management?

Common structures include sociétés anonymes, limited liability companies, and partnerships. The choice depends on investment goals, capital, and risk appetite.

What are the main compliance requirements for fund managers?

Fund managers must be licensed, ensure transparency with investors, segregate assets, maintain robust anti-money laundering procedures, and submit regular reports to authorities.

How are disputes between investors and managers usually resolved?

Disputes may be resolved through negotiation, mediation, or, if necessary, by seeking recourse with the courts or the HCMC.

Are foreign investors allowed to invest or manage funds in Larissa?

Yes, foreign investors and managers are welcome but must comply with Greek and EU regulations, including registration and reporting obligations.

What tax considerations apply to funds and asset managers?

Taxation depends on the structure and activities of the fund. Greece offers certain incentives, but there are also withholding taxes and VAT considerations. Consulting a tax advisor is recommended.

What risks should I be aware of in fund management?

Risks include market volatility, regulatory breaches, operational mistakes, and potential legal liability for mismanagement or failure to disclose information.

How can I check if a fund or manager is properly licensed?

You can verify licensing status through the Hellenic Capital Market Commission, which maintains a public registry of authorized firms and professionals.
